HIP 35124
HIP 35124 is a K-type (Orange) star located in the constellation Gemini.
Located approximately 535.6 light-years from Earth, HIP 35124 resides within the broader disk of our Milky Way galaxy.
HIP 35124 is classified as a spectral class K star (K-type (Orange)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.
HIP 35124 has an apparent magnitude of +8.10, placing it beyond naked-eye visibility. A good pair of binoculars or a small telescope is required to observe this star. Observers will note its orange h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+1.160.
